Tara's practice emphasizes bankruptcy, creditors' rights, and commercial litigation. She is a tough negotiator and skilled litigator who knows how to balance clients' business interests with legal needs to save time, effort and business capital.

She represents all types of parties in all types of bankruptcy matters including business debtors in reorganization proceedings, creditors including banks and other financial service providers, bankruptcy trustees, unsecured creditors committees, and receivers. She protects clients' interests and represents them on a national level in multiple bankruptcy jurisdictions.

Tara is certified by the American Board of Certification as a business bankruptcy specialist and holds a Master's Degree in Business Administration. Her business acumen allows her to effectively handle all aspects of complicated Chapter 11s, receiverships, workouts and other insolvency issues including adversary proceedings and contested matters.

In her litigation practice Tara has represented clients in numerous arbitration proceedings and trials in both Oregon and Washington in state and federal courts. She has litigated a diverse array of cases including bankruptcy-related matters, commercial and business disputes, employment matters, ski-industry defense, and real estate disputes. In addition, Tara provides estate planning to individuals.

Tara was recognized by her peers and selected to the Oregon Super Lawyers list in 2008, 2009 and 2010 for bankruptcy law. She has practiced with Farleigh Wada Witt since 1997, and currently serves on the firm's Executive Committee.
